Consider the heat of the day. I had a P100 box as a firewall and it
would stop working during the day when it was extremely hot.  Heat can
expand things and open a dry solder joint or cause problems with
computers not cooled correctly.

I had a problem with the cable.  The cable modem has an actual address
that you can talk to to find out the signal strength of the cable.  The
joints of the cable up the pole corroded after a few years.  They moved
the connector and it was better.  They ended up rerunning the cable into
my house because it was not 100% reliable.  Since then it is fine.
